Est-ce que le Dipladenia perd ses feuilles ?

Lorsque vous rentrez le dipladénia en automne, il se peut qu’il perde ses feuilles car, comme la plupart des plantes, il n’aime pas changer de place. Mais il en refera au printemps. Cultivé en serre ou en véranda, le dipladénia est sensible à l’araignée rouge et à la cochenilles farineuse.

Is Dipladenia an indoor plant?

  • Dipladenia, a favorite, is a South American native that grows in tropical forests. The plant is similar to mandevilla vine and works outside in warm zones, or indoors as an accent houseplant. … Dipladenia is a bushier plant whose stems grow down and hang.

Does Dipladenia need staking?

  • Unlike the mandevilla, dipladenia doesn’t send out as much upward growth and doesn’t need staking. One of the better dipladenia facts is its ability to attract hummingbirds and bees. How do I choose the difference between a mandevilla and Dipladenia?

  • When deciding between a mandevilla or dipladenia, the finer leaves and smaller flowers in a wide range of colors may win the day for the dipladenia. Dipladenia has a fuller shape than the mandevilla. A major difference between dipladenia and mandevilla is the foliage. Dipladenia leaves are fine and pointed, deeply green and slightly glossy.
